If there is something I'd say to sum up the text/ presentation, that'd be: language is not something you have, but something you are.
After reading about CCP, it is clear that language is an outfit for people to use in different circumstances and, like clothing as well, language models itself to the purpose we want to achieve. Indeed, it is a big lesson to learn if we want to "dress up ourselves with language" at home, school, work, considering the slight differences of each culture/ society. I really like this challenge, since the aim is not making people proficient in a given language, but make them aware to communicate. Hard isn't it?
